> If I do (add-hook 'gnus-article-decode-hook 'function-which-does-nothing),
> articles are no longer recoded, they are assumed to be ISO-8859-1.

> How to perform something when an article is decoded, without stopping
> decoding from working?

Even in the .gnus.el file, you need to do that as follows:

(eval-after-load "gnus-art"
  '(add-hook 'gnus-article-decode-hook 'function-which-does-nothing))

or

(require 'gnus-art)
(add-hook 'gnus-article-decode-hook 'function-which-does-nothing)

It is because gnus-article-decode-hook is defined in gnus-art.elc
which will not be loaded normally when Gnus starts, and just
using add-hook voids the default value.
